Gaming is about to get a lot more pink this Valentine's Day with new additions to Razer's Quartz Pink line

Image via Razer

Razer co-founder and CEO Min-Liang Tan announced yesterday, 29 January, that the brand will be adding eight more products to the Quartz Pink line - which was first introduced last year with just four peripherals to its name.

"Our fans told us they could not get enough of our Quartz Pink editions. We listened and we have given the stunning pink treatment to our latest gaming gear, giving you the unfair advantage in both performance and looks," said Tan.

The line will see the 'pinkification' of some of Razer's most iconic peripherals, including the Razer Basilisk mouse and Razer Huntsman keyboard

The two products retail at RM329 and RM649, respectively. 

Razer Seiren X microphone and Razer Kraken headset on Razer Base Station Chroma headset stand in Quartz Pink.

Image via Razer

Here are the other products getting the treatment:
- Razer Goliathus Extended Chroma mouse mat (RM269),
- Razer Kraken headset (RM529),
- Razer Seiren X microphone (RM499),
- Razer Base Station Chroma headset stand (RM279), and
- Quartz case for Razer Phone 2 (RM119).

One of the most exciting additions to the line would be the Razer Blade Stealth 13 Quartz Pink laptop

Image via Razer

According to Kotaku, the limited edition 13" productivity laptop sports an Nvidia GeForce MX 150 4GB graphics, 16GB of dual channel memory, and an 8th generation Intel i7-8565U processor.

It's light, it's pretty, and it's unfortunately only available in USA, China, and Canada.

Instead, we get the Razer Raiju Tournament Edition controller for PlayStation 4

Image via Razer

Only available in Europe, Asia, and Oceania, the fully modular controller retails at RM729.
